Unique Dasa combinations
A Dasa is an Asterism based progression, quite unique to Vedic Astrology. Every graha or planetary body gets a weighted period on which it acts on a native. Those set periods can be recursively divided in similar weighted manner into sub periods and their sub periods, bringing an event’s occurrence to within a few days. Of course, one can recursively traverse the function to get to sub units of time, but for ease of understanding most ancient texts like this blog, limited it to three grahas only.
Understanding a Dasa period is not easy as many factors influence the period it represents. It’s sub divisions make the challenge exponential and further sub divisions further increase the complexity.
Any Dasa combination of Mars, Jupiter and Saturn overwhelms one half of the natal zodiac. These grahas are the lords of 8th, 9th, 10th sign; lords of 11th, 12th and 1st sign. From Scorpio to Aries is completely under the influence of the three Grahas, in their Dasa rulership. Of course, depending on how the houses are distributed from the ascendant (lagna), the combination of the three Grahas can exert lopsided pressures on one half of the native’s chart. I have witnessed some incredible results during the Dasa-Antara-Pratyantara of the three. If the period lasts 6 months, each month gets a unique (3 x 2) influence. Gain in wealth in one month with extra losses in another month, or loss of wealth followed by a gain; loss of health followed by an incredible recovery and similar yin-yang combinations occur within that short span of time.
A similar combination to the one described comes from Sun, Moon and Mercury dasa period. They involve a third of the native’s chart starting from the 3rd to the 6th sign. If such a region lies between 1st to 4th or 2nd to 5th house, the results could be really good.

DIY - Jotiz CardioMachine with Arduino Due and TI MSP 432 and MSP 430
DIY - Jotiz CardioMachine with Arduino Due and TI MSP 432 and MSP 430
I present here a series of blogs that are intended to enable the use of ‘things’ in the Internet of Things IoT complementing Jotiz.
The idea of a Microcontroller based Cardiogram Reading machine was something I had planned on for quite a while. There is little to doubt that Panchanga and Kaala have a definite influence on a person’s mind, spirit and heart. Based on that key-note, I went about assembling a small machine that could fit into your palm, read EKG through electrodes on your body and correlate heart readings to the Panchanga and Kaala of time.
There were several architectural alternatives, which I went through and I present them all to you.
1. Arduino Mega (8 Bit) MCU with Olimex EKG/EMG front-end shield.
2. Arduino Due (32 Bit SAMX) MCU with Olimex EKG/EMG front end shield
3. TI MSP 430 (16 Bit) Launchpad with SparkFun EKG front end board
4. TI MSP 423 (32 Bit) Launchpad with SparkFun EKG front end board
The TI Launchpads were connected headless to the EKG front ends. The data was collected over the serial port through a program written in Java, which would plot and render the data on the cloud. To the Arduino boards, I added shields I had created which had LCD and OLEDs mounted additional to the EKG front ends.

I present here a series of blogs that are intended to enable the use of ‘things’ in the Internet of Things IoT complementing Jotiz.The CC3200 Launchpad from Texas Instruments is new generation 32 bit MCU with SoC and WiFi built it. In this article, I present the CC3200 micro-controller and its ability to read the Jotiz web service which gives the Panchanga. The development board is the size of a credit card and comes as an attractive red PCB. I also attached a Sharp 96x96 LCD booster pack on the MCU board to display the results. All this, I put into an acrylic enclosure with spacers and screws.
The Simplelink WiFi CC3200 Launchpad was connected to a Windows 7 laptop through the USB port. Remember to download the drivers for CC3200 from TI website. To develop the program, the Open Source Energia based on the Arduino IDE was used.

Ballad Divine brings back the Bhagavad-Gita in a very easy to read composition; minus the rhetoric. It is an accurate reference of the original and observed facts and uses the same systemic method to divinity.
Ballad-Divine is organized around the mainstays of Krishna's doctrines, those of philosophy, action, discipline, concentration, knowledge, meditation, devotion and surrender. These pillars are in turn expounded from smaller building blocks. The theme in the sentences are repeated throughout reinforcing the subject. It is styled mostly as a ballad expressing eighteen different chapters by short stanzas; of which some are metrical.
